Shower regrouting services involve removing old, deteriorated grout lines between tiles and replacing them with fresh, durable grout. This process helps restore the appearance of a shower’s tiled surfaces, making them look cleaner and newer. Regrouting also involves sealing the gaps between tiles to prevent water from seeping behind the tiles, which can cause damage over time. This service is a practical way to refresh a bathroom without the need for a full tile replacement, offering a cost-effective solution for maintaining the look and integrity of shower areas.
One of the primary problems addressed by shower regrouting is the development of mold, mildew, or staining in the grout lines. Over time, grout can become discolored, cracked, or crumbly, creating an unsightly appearance and potentially leading to water leaks. Regrouting helps eliminate these issues by replacing compromised grout with fresh material that resists moisture buildup. This not only improves the visual appeal but also enhances the overall hygiene and safety of the shower space, especially in homes where moisture control is a concern.

The overview below groups typical Shower Regrouting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Erie, CO.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typically, minor regrouting jobs for showers in Erie, CO, cost between $250 and $600. Many routine fixes fall within this range, especially for areas with limited tile surface. Larger or more complex repairs may exceed this range, but are less common.
Standard Regrouting Projects - For most shower regrouting services, local contractors usually charge between $600 and $1,200. This range covers typical bathroom sizes and common tile issues, with many projects completing within this band.
Extensive or Multiple Bathrooms - Larger jobs involving multiple showers or extensive tile removal often range from $1,200 to $3,000. These projects tend to be less frequent but are necessary for more comprehensive upgrades or repairs.
Full Shower Replacements - Complete regrouting combined with shower replacement can cost $3,000 or more, depending on the scope and materials used. Larger, more complex projects can reach $5,000+ but are less typical for routine maintenance need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is shower regrouting? Shower regrouting involves removing old, damaged grout between tiles and replacing it with fresh grout to improve appearance and prevent water damage.
Why should I consider shower regrouting instead of replacing tiles? Regrouting is often a more cost-effective and less invasive way to refresh the look of a shower and address grout-related issues without the need for extensive tile replacement.
What signs indicate that regrouting may be needed? Signs include discoloration, cracking, or crumbling grout, as well as water seeping behind tiles or mold growth in grout lines.
How do local service providers handle shower regrouting projects? Local contractors typically prepare the area, remove damaged grout, and carefully apply new grout to ensure a durable and clean finish.
Can regrouting help prevent water damage in my shower? Yes, properly applied regrouting can seal gaps and cracks, reducing the risk of water infiltration and potential damage behind tiles.
